  • FT: Chesterfield 3 v 2 Dover Athletic (3pm KO)
  • Visitors take lead through Gyasi on 14 minutes; Khan equalises 10 minutes later
  • Goodman puts Dover in front on 81; Khan instant equaliser on 82; King then scores on 85
  • Spireites 5th; Dover rock bottom
  • Three changes for Chesterfield as Maguire, Oyeleke and Khan replace Gunning, Kellermann and Denton
  • (3-4-2-1) Loach; Williams, Grimes, Maguire; King, Weston, Oyeleke, Whittle; Khan, Mandeville; Asante. Subs: Miller, Kellermann, McCourt, Whelan, Denton.
